aip

Google API Improvement Proposals (AIP)

Safety Notice

This listing is imported from skills.sh public index metadata. Review upstream SKILL.md and repository scripts before running.

Copy this and send it to your AI assistant to learn

Install skill "aip" with this command: npx skills add fredrikaverpil/dotfiles/fredrikaverpil-dotfiles-aip

Google API Improvement Proposals (AIP)

When working on API design, protobuf definitions, or any task involving Google API standards, refresh your understanding of the relevant AIP rules.

Critical Rule

NEVER assume you know what an AIP rule says from memory. Always fetch and read the actual AIP documentation before applying or referencing any rule. Your memory of AIP rules may be inaccurate or outdated.

Process

  • Browse the AIP index - Go to https://google.aip.dev/general to see all available AIP guidelines

  • Identify relevant AIPs - Based on the task at hand, determine which AIP rules may apply

  • Fetch and read the relevant AIPs - Use WebFetch to retrieve the specific AIP pages. Do NOT skip this step, even if you think you know what the rule says

  • Apply the standards - Ensure your work follows the AIP guidelines as documented

When to Invoke This Skill

  • Designing new API endpoints or protobuf messages

  • Reviewing API changes in PRs

  • Implementing resource-oriented services

  • Naming fields, methods, or resources

  • Working with google.api annotations

Source Transparency

This detail page is rendered from real SKILL.md content. Trust labels are metadata-based hints, not a safety guarantee.

Related Skills

Related by shared tags or category signals.

General

golang-style

No summary provided by upstream source.

Repository SourceNeeds Review
General

gh-pr

No summary provided by upstream source.

Repository SourceNeeds Review
General

skill-creator

No summary provided by upstream source.

Repository SourceNeeds Review
General

git-commit

No summary provided by upstream source.

Repository SourceNeeds Review